Cap'n Proto 1.0
This is also because Google's Protobuf implementations aren't doing a very good job with avoiding unnecessary allocations. Gogoproto is better and it is possible to do even better, here is an example prototype I have put together for Go (even if you do not use the laziness part it is still much faster than Google's implementation): https://github.com/splunk/exp-lazyproto
